#db4559 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db4559 is composed of 85.9% red, 27.1%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 56.5%. #db4559 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ab2 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#db4559 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db4559 has RGB values of R:219, G:69,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.59,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14370137.

Shades and Tints of #db4559
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0203 is the darkest color, while #fefaf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#db4559
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97898b is the less saturated color, while #fd2340 is the most saturated one.
